They say most people who decide to build an online business end up failing. While there is no way to get the exact numbers, some estimate that over 75% of people who start an online business end up failing. Others put the numbers as high as 90%. If you are thinking of starting or expanding an online business, these numbers are not quite encouraging. They just might push you to think that there is no way to have success in the online world. Obviously, this is not true. Just like in any other business, there are some people who will do better than others.
Now the main question remains, WHY did these people actually fail. And did they really “fail” or simply gave up? Don’t believe for a second the “gurus” out there who tell you that people fail in IM because they didn’t know the “top secret success formula” that they are selling. This is simply a marketing tactic and nothing more. In the online world, there is no such thing as “lack of information”. In fact, there is plenty of information available out there, for free, to anyone that wants it. People can find free ebooks, guides, blog posts, videos, discussion forums, etc. where they can find all about online business methods, techniques and strategies. You just have to find the information and apply it.
But you have to ask yourself a question: are you an entrepreneur, or just someone looking for a quick buck. There are some differences between the two. The true entrepreneur will always look for ways to make their business achieve its goals and grow. He is willing to adapt to change and learn new ideas to make money. Someone thinking that internet marketing is about “making money fast from home” simply wants that: to make some money easily. The problem is, once they have made the money they needed this month to pay their bills or go shopping, they are happy. They stop. They don’t think of ways they can reinvest their profits to make even more money. What’s more, they don’t structure their business properly.
In the online world, diversifying your activities and having multiple backup plans available will make or break you. Bad things happen. Affiliate programs fold without paying members. Servers can crash. Products could lose their popularity, etc, etc. Someone who is actually building their online business understands that and will have multiple tools, strategies and income streams at their disposal so that they can continue operating no matter what happens. And if a project they are working on doesn’t give them the results they want, they ask themselves why. Then they apply the necessary corrections and try again, until they found something that actually works and let them achieve their goals with regards to the income they want to generate.
